    These photos were taken on the lower east hillside of Duluth on the afternoon following a night and morning of heavy rain.
    Broken steam pipes brought a release into the street at E. 8th Ave. near Superior St., along with attention from city workers.
    The man on the roof of his car is Ian Koivisto. He drove his car into this flooded area at 1 a.m. this morning and had to swim to safety. Here he recovers his belongings, using the chair to stand above the water while he accesses the trunk.
    The apartment building with the uprooted sidewalk, is at E. 2nd St. and 8th Ave.
    The storm sewer emptying into Lake Superior is at the base of the hill from where the car fell into the sinkhole on Skyline Parkway.
